Output cbad027a256bcc08cf31b24a66f207f57b68152117a43e7eab27f4e4fa8baeff:2

value
11860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0e64c98315af76c1dacf91d68d107e04cd5e424 OP_EQUAL
address
3NCBAywSxLBT4TC3NKmEk35Mwcw7GYzz3a
transaction
cbad027a256bcc08cf31b24a66f207f57b68152117a43e7eab27f4e4fa8baeff
confirmations
287052
spent
true